免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

js 开发安卓app

JavaScript(JS)是一种用于编写交互式网页的脚本语言。但是,很多人可能不知道,JavaScript也可以用来开发安卓应用程序。本文将介绍如何使用JavaScript开发安卓应用程序的原理和详细步骤。

### 安卓应用程序开发概述

安卓应用程序开发主要使用Java编程语言。Java是一种通用的、面向对象的编程语言,被广泛应用于安卓应用程序开发。然而,开发人员也可以使用其他编程语言,如JavaScript,来开发安卓应用程序。

### 使用JavaScript开发安卓应用程序的原理

实际上,JavaScript并不能直接用于开发原生的安卓应用程序。而是通过使用一些中间件或框架,将JavaScript代码转换为原生的安卓应用程序代码。

其中,最常用的框架是React Native。React Native是Facebook开发的一个开源框架,可以用JavaScript编写安卓和iOS应用程序。它允许开发人员使用React的UI库,以及JavaScript进行安卓应用程序的开发。

### 使用React Native开发安卓应用程序的步骤

下面是使用React Native开发安卓应用程序的详细步骤:

#### 步骤1:安装React Native

首先,你需要在你的电脑上安装React Native。你可以参考React Native官方文档的指导来完成安装。

#### 步骤2:创建新的React Native项目

使用React Native的命令行工具,你可以创建一个新的React Native项目。在命令行中,输入以下命令:

```

npx react-native init MyProject

```

这将会创建一个名为"MyProject"的新项目。

#### 步骤3:编写JavaScript代码

在项目的根目录下,你会看到一个名为"App.js"的文件。这就是你编写JavaScript代码的地方。你可以使用任何你熟悉的文本编辑器,在这个文件中编写你的JavaScript代码。

#### 步骤4:运行应用程序

在命令行中,你可以使用以下命令来运行你的应用程序:

```

npx react-native run-android

```

这将会启动安卓模拟器,并在模拟器中运行你的应用程序。

#### 步骤5:调试和测试

你可以使用React Native提供的调试工具来调试和测试你的应用程序。这些工具可以帮助你查找和修复代码中的错误和问题。

### 总结

使用JavaScript开发安卓应用程序的原理是将JavaScript代码转换为原生的安卓应用程序代码,通过一些框架和工具来实现。React Native是目前最常用的框架之一,它允许开发人员使用JavaScript编写安卓应用程序。希望本文对你了解使用JavaScript开发安卓应用程序有所帮助。


相关知识:
如何开发一款直播app
随着移动互联网的发展,直播已经成为一种非常流行的娱乐方式,很多人都喜欢通过直播来分享自己的生活、展示才艺、进行游戏竞技等等。如果你也想开发一款直播app,那么可以按照以下步骤进行。一、确定需求在开发一款直播app之前,首先要确定自己的需求。要考虑的问题包括
2024-01-10
如何为特斯拉开发app
随着特斯拉电动汽车的普及,越来越多的人开始使用特斯拉车辆,同时也需要特斯拉车主专属的手机应用程序来管理他们的车辆。这个应用程序可以让车主远程锁定和解锁车门,调整车辆座椅和温度,查看电池状态和车辆位置等等。那么,如何为特斯拉开发这个应用程序呢?下面是一些原理
2024-01-10
全国app开发项目对接现场实录
全国app开发项目对接现场是一场为了促进国内app开发行业发展的大型活动,旨在为各地区、各行业的企业和个人提供一个交流、合作的平台,共同推动中国app产业的发展。本次现场活动吸引了来自全国各地的app开发公司、互联网公司、创业团队和个人等近千名参与者。活动
2024-01-10
app扩展开发
App扩展开发是指在移动应用程序中添加额外的功能或特性,以提供更多的功能和增强用户体验。这些扩展可以是插件、模块、小部件、主题或其他形式的定制化组件。在本文中,我将详细介绍App扩展开发的原理和相关知识。一、App扩展的原理App扩展的原理是基于应用程序的
2023-06-29
app开发必知的运营模式
APP开发业务的成功离不开一个具体的运营模式。这个模式需要从多个维度考虑,包括APP的目标用户群体、服务于用户的功能和特色、平台流量、推广渠道、盈利模式等多方面。在此,我们将重点讨论APP开发必知的运营模式及其原理或详细介绍。1. 免费下载与内置消费让用户
2023-06-29
app的开发流程图
App的开发流程图可以分为以下几个主要阶段:1. 需求分析和规划阶段:在这个阶段,开发者需要了解客户的需求和目标,分析应用程序的用途和功能,制定开发计划和提供需求文档。需要与客户沟通并确保明确的开发要求和可行性分析。2. UI设计阶段:在这个阶段,开发者需
2023-05-06